Oh man powdery mildew can be the plague . It always pops it s ugly head if your ambient humidity gets above 50% basically . I remember never seeing pm when i was working in Colorado where it's dry . If left untreated it spreads like wildfire . It's early so you might take care to remove the infected leaves and spray w biowar or whatever you use as preventative. Even if it's just water . Then as stated maybe use sulfur burner. as it's early . Sulfur changes the ph on the leaf surface so it won't spread as much. It's phototoxic and should never be used on meds when flowers are well established IMO . I'm not a big fan but it is common practice. U Smell it all over grape country. Watch that humidity it probably did not help when your pump sprayed water everywhere .

Photo toxic simply means never Burn sulfur during the daytime, and be sure to exhaust well before lights come on. Plants perform a process called cellular respiration in which they absorb carbon dioxide through the stomata( pores on leaf). Sulfur and pyrethrum are two things that are phototoxic . What happens is the plant " inhales" the sulfur rapidly and it pretty much instantly frys the plant. Full on necrosis of your previously lovely green lady. . IMO never use sulfur late in flower that is unless you like the taste . Worst idea ever!!! Please read MSDS before you decide to spray with Conserve SC and definitely if you are thinking about using Eagle 20! OGBiowar can handle everything if you use it from start to finish... Pretty easy to brew batches of this and know that you don't have to wear any protective gear or that you aren't damaging the ecosystems nearby. Both Conserve SC and Eagle 20 are bad for aquatic invertebrates and small fish. Which are an important part of the food chain to many other species out there. Can't catch those big fish if all those small fish have died off or have diseases and mutations.
